Award-winning French pianist to play in Hanoi 

January 12, 2012
Award-winning French pianist to play in Hanoi 

  A young French award winner will perform piano solos at the French cultural center L’Escape in Hanoi on February 9. Marie Vermeulin, who finished second at the International Olivier Messiaen in 2007 and the Maria Canals international competition in Barcelona in 2006, will perform at the center at 24 Trang Tien from 8 pm.
